It's been a heck of a week for new gear for me. My wife said she wanted to get me a new shirt to celebrate some recent work success. We narrowed it down to the IHSH-326-BLK and the Samurai 'Sengen' Jacquard Work Shirt. I chose the 326 and thought it was over. As it turns out, she (sneakily) got me both.
Just wanted to give some love to the Sengen here. It's got a great drape, almost like a light/medium weight knit blanket. Airy but very soft. You can't really see the pattern that well in new stock photos but from my closeups below, hopefully you can tell the pattern + the indigo/indigo gives it interesting fade potential. I love the cat's eye, mother-of-pearl style buttons too. If I had any criticism, I wish the top button was a little lower. It's in an awkward place where unbuttoned is too much chest, but buttoned is too restrictive to movement. But not a big deal with the shirt being so soft. The one I got from Rivet and Hyde is part of their "western" lineup so the XXL I got fits more like a traditional Japanese XXXL. It's a little billowy at the moment, but I prefer that to tight these days, and I'm thinking it may come in and mold a bit over time with wear/washing.

I won’t be getting any bonus points for rare or unique pieces. I’ve been into the standards from the start.
My first jeans were 633 21oz shown here, purchased spring 2021 at SENY. Gosh I forgot how comfy they are. My first shirts were 1600 Ts, followed by the IHSH-07 hickory western. Love that one, but the moiré effect makes it a bit much for a normal workday, so I’m going with this (now too small) 33OD instead (purchased from Dant summer 2021). These Wescos were also my first foray into proper boots.
The forum has had a big influence on my purchasing over the years. I’m also wearing JMM glasses, a vintage Seiko, and even the deodorant/aftershave/hair texture I use came from recommendations here. It’s been a good place to while away some time.
